Nodeloom renders dependency graphs incrementally: a coarse layout pass first, then refinement only for the visible viewport. This keeps large graphs responsive but makes output sensitive to the refinement budget and collision padding. Future maintainers should treat these as a coupled set — changing one without re-benchmarking against the Ferncastle fixture graphs has caused regressions twice. The present tuning constants are given below.

tuning table, yajog-yahof:
BUDGETS = {
    "lamvan": 303,
    "wenox": 460,
    "fenvan": 525,
}

Subject: Second-Source Supplier Search — Update

Team, the sourcing group at Norvale Systems has shortlisted three candidate suppliers for the Axiom valve assembly, with site audits scheduled over the next six weeks. Branch managers should hold current order volumes steady until qualification completes. The commercial reasoning behind this initiative is set out in the note below.

internal memo for hahif-hahaf: Headcount on the Zorwyn team goes from 9 to 100 by the end of October. Gross margin on Zorwyn came in at 5 percent against a plan of 10 percent.

This briefing outlines the planned restructuring of the Amberline Rewards programme ahead of next month's leadership review. The current points model costs roughly 3.1% of revenue while driving limited repeat purchase among mid-tier members. The proposal replaces accrual points with tiered benefits, reducing liability on the balance sheet and simplifying redemption accounting. Finance should note the one-time write-down of unredeemed points in the transition quarter. The confidential commercial rationale appears directly below.

confidential, kagep-kahof: Druokax Systems plans to lower the Ulaath list price by 53 percent in March.

# Loyalty ledger constants — Perkstone module.
#
# Support team: these values explain most "missing points" tickets.
# Points post after the settlement delay, expire per the window below,
# and adjustments over the manual-credit cap require a supervisor
# approval in the admin tool. Negative balances are clamped at the
# floor; anything beyond that is a merchant chargeback, not a ledger
# bug. Do not quote these numbers to customers — reference the public
# policy page instead. Current values follow.

tuning constants:
QUOTAS = {
    "druwyn": 5,
    "holix": 5,
    "zorath": 5,
    "holwyn": 10,
}